Crime overview

Ingate Place area has the 49th highest crime rate of 99 local areas in Battersea Park , and the 236th highest crime rate of 825 local areas in Wandsworth .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Ingate Place (SW8 3NS) in the last 12 months was 121.3 per 1,000 residents and was 0.9% lower than the Battersea Park average (122.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 17 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 23 (β‰ˆ 56.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 15.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 107.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Ingate Place (SW8 3NS), the main crime hotspot is near Bradmead. Police recorded 69 crimes here, including 25 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
